Chapter 4. Special Effects
In this chapter I share some special effects that I regularly use in my own pictures.
I'm often asked how I create these effects and whether they come from using third-party
plug-ins. The great thing is that they're all created within Photoshop, and each one is quick
and easy to produce.
Over the next few pages I'll show you techniques I use for turning day into night, creating
a cartoon/painterly effect, and making your own dust, debris, snow, and rain brushes. Plus, I
show a quick and easy black and white conversion technique, and how to fake the wet look.
